THE ARTIST AND THE ARTISANS ARTS APPRECIATION CHAPTER 4

Identify the medium in various forms of art, viz., visual, auditory and combined arts ; Define the artist's or artisan's medium and technique ; Define the role of managers, curators, buyers, collectors and art dealers in the art world ; Differentiate between artists and artisan's approach/technique toward a particular medium ; Understand the artisan's work as an end in itself and the artist's work as a means to an end and I dentify national and GAMABA artist's notable works and their contribution to society. ARTIST VS. ARTISAN Artist All fine artists first learn to sketch and begin with a pencil and sketchpad to work with an idea on paper. Artists transfer their visions to canvas or other medium,and this may mean working in pencils, oil, watercolor or pastels. Artisan Artisans are craftsmen who make practical artistic products, such as earrings, urns, stained glass and other accessories. Artisans gain their knowledge by studying under master craftsmen and then practicing with continued study.

Republic Act No. 7355 or also known as Gawad sa Manlilikha ng Bayan (GAMABA) or the National Living Treasures Award, passed by the Philippine Congress to recognize Philippine Artists. The implementing agency of this law is the National Commission for Culture and Arts (NCCA). As envisioned under R.A. 7355, Manlilikha ng Bayan shall mean a citizen engaged in any traditional art uniquely Filipino whose distinctive skills have reached, such a high level of technical and artistic excellence and have been passed on to and widely practiced by the present generation in his/her community with the same degree of technical and artistic competence .

Qualifications to Become a Manlilikha ng Bayan based on the NCCA Guidelines (NCCA, 2020): He/she is an inhabitant of an indigenous/traditional cultural community anywhere in the Philippines that has preserved indigenous customs , beliefs , rituals and traditions and/or has syncretized whatever external elements that have influenced it . He/she must have engaged in a folk-art tradition that has been in existence and documented for at least fifty (50) years.

He/she must have passed on and/or will pass on to other members of the community their skills in the folk art for which the community is traditionally known. He/she must possess a mastery of tools and materials needed by the art and must have an established reputation in the art as master and maker of works of extraordinary technical quality. He/she must have consistently performed or produced over a significant period, works of superior and distinctive quality.

Even if the traditional artist is incapable of teaching his/her masterpiece due to advanced age or sickness, he/she can still be rewarded if: He/she had created a significant body of works and/or has consistently displayed excellence in the practice of his/her art, thus achieving important contributions for its development. He/she has been instrumental in the revitalization of his/her community's artistic tradition.

He/she has passed on to the other members of the community skills in the folk art for which the community is traditionally known. His/her community has recognized him/her as master and teacher of his/her craft.

C ategories Folk architecture Maritime transport Weaving Carving Performing arts Literature Graphic and plastic arts Ornament Textile or fiber art Pottery and other artistic expressions of traditional culture

What are the incentives received by the awardee? A GAMABA awardee initially receives a Php 100,000; Php10,000 monthly financial assistance; and a gold medallion. In consonance with the provision of Republic Act No. 7355 , which states that “the monetary grant may be increased whenever circumstances so warrant,” the NCCA board approved an additional monthly personal allowance of P14,000 for the awardees as well as a maximum cumulative amount of 750,000 medical and hospitalization benefits annually similar to that received by the National Artists and funeral assistance/tribute fit for a National Living Treasure (NCCA, 2020).

Ad Hoc Panel of Experts I s a temporary group of experts brought together to address a specific issue or task. The term "ad hoc" means "as needed ". To ensure a fair selection of the potential awardees, the Gawad sa Manlilikha ng Bayan Committee shall be assisted by an Ad Hoc Panel of Experts consisting of experts in the traditional folk arts categories listed above. The names of those selected to become members of the Ad Hoc Panel, of Experts shall be submitted to the NCCA Board of Commissioners for proper designation.
